PathHunter™ eXpress β-Arrestin GPCR Kits
Universal GPCR Technology for Direct Pharmacology in Live Cells
The PathHunter™ eXpress β-Arrestin GPCR assays are based on the proven PathHunter™ β-Arrestin technology which is a universal method for detection of GPCR activity regardless of coupling status. Unlike second messenger or other imaging assays, the PathHunter β-Arrestin assay is unique in that it provides a direct measure of β-Arrestin binding to the GPCR of interest and can be used with any Gi-, Gq-, Gs-coupled receptor.

How the PathHunter™ eXpress β-Arrestin GPCR Assay Works
In this system, β-Arrestin is fused to an N-terminal deletion mutant of β-gal (termed the enzyme acceptor, EA) and the GPCR of interest is fused to a smaller (42 amino acids), weakly complementing fragment termed ProLink™. In cells that stably express these fusion proteins, the interaction of β-Arrestin and the GPCR following ligand stimulation forces the complementation of the two β-gal fragments resulting in the formation of a functional enzyme that converts substrate to detectable signal. In the absence of an interaction between the GPCR and β-Arrestin, the enzyme activity is low due to the low affinity of the two enzyme fragments.
